Porphyrin as the nonliner optical materials was noted extensively. In this thesis,we prepared and characterized5,10,15,20-tetrakis [4-phenyl] porphyrin,tetra (p-sulphonic phenyl) porphyrin and its Zn complex (ZnTPPS4),Co complex (CoTPPS4).And we studied the synthesis,separation,purification methods of porphyrin and metallporphyrin. Characterizaed the structure and properties of porphyrin and metallporphyrin by FT-IR,UV-Vis.Self-assembly technique is used for preparing composite films on the surface of glass and Silicon chips by alternating fabrication of cationic polyelectrolyte (PEI or GO) and anionic sulfonated metalloporphyrin. The third-order nonlinear optical properties of the the three kind of solutions were measured by Z-scanning technique,Experiments show that the TPPS4and ZnTPPS4with nonlinear character,PEI/ZnTHPP4,GO/ZnTHPP4self-assembly films shows the nonlinear character in the six kinds of self-assembly films.
